Kathryn Taylor Equestrian Park
Kathryn Taylor Equestrian Park, located in Woodinville, WA, is a 27-acre tribute to the late Kathryn Taylor, who championed the establishment of this equestrian facility. Opened in 2008, the park features a 100 x 200 ft arena, a 60 ft round pen, and access to the Tolt River Pipeline trail, serving as a vibrant space for local equestrians to enjoy and preserve the equestrian way of life.
The park operates with a spirit of community, promoting shared use among riders while adhering to specific facility and arena rules to ensure safety and respect for all participants. Volunteers play a key role in maintaining the park's cleanliness and overall upkeep, fostering a collaborative environment for horse enthusiasts.
